Now before faith came, we were held captive under the law, imprisoned until the coming faith would be revealed. So then, the law was our guardian until Christ came, in order that we might be justified by faith. But now that faith has come, we are no longer under a guardian, for in Christ Jesus you are all sons of God, through faith. For as many of you as were baptized into Christ have put on Christ. There is neither Jew nor Greek, there is neither slave nor free, there is no male and female, for you are all one in Christ Jesus. And if you are Christ’s, then you are Abraham’s offspring, heirs according to promise. Galatians 3:23-29
It’s not what I was born, where I was born, or even who I was born but why I was born. We were born to be children of promise. This life was intended to be lived in the promises of God, trusting Him and loving Him. There are neither Jew nor Greek, slave or free, male or female but only children of promise, in the presence of God. Jesus was the fulfillment of God’s promise to us and Jesus showed us how to live as children of promise by living as God’s Son of promise. That’s why the true believer doesn’t just believe in Jesus but believes Jesus. This life is lived in the promises of God by the power of God for the purpose of God. We are all sons of God through faith. The law, you might say, kept us looking forward to a redeemer. The life of Jesus keeps us looking up at our Redeemer, loving and living in His promises, not our past, pain, problems, paranoia or perversion.
